I attended the Summit II for the Fund on April 8, 2011. There are a few
problems with their website which I think we may be able to correct.
It takes three clicks to get to the contact phone numbers.
A. Setting the numbers in a banner on top of their homepage may fix that.
B. Some of these children may not be able to read, thus will not know what the
word “contact” means. Maybe just using the word “help”.
1. Giving them a phone number – even assuring them that the taxi or private
car being sent is being driven by a trustworthy person – may not be enough.
Some of these children have been on the street – pimping themselves or
being pimped—since the age of six or seven. Being told the person coming to
pick them up will have ID's may not be enough. At their young age, they are
already very world weary. I am not sure what the solution for this is.
1. The older children may have committed crimes – either to feed
themselves—or to appease the criminal that “adopted” them. One pimp was
quoted as saying: “They get three days in Heaven and spend the rest of their
days in hell.”
I hope someone can come up with other ideas to solve the painful situation these
children (young and old) are in. We can supply computers, but getting the
children to the shelters for their own safety is a very different problem. Yet
it is something that needs to be in place quickly. Their lives may depend upon
it.
